Transaction ea18608b3943f1f880222f36e96fc26e5a26d9d25c21eaad3d9a92e7a0c535d1
1 Input
1 Output
-
ea18608b3943f1f880222f36e96fc26e5a26d9d25c21eaad3d9a92e7a0c535d1:0
- value
- 4291710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 866548fe0cf5c3f9e74812cfbe12f58c4afeba29 OP_EQUAL
- address
- 3DwdofQZhGpbV62BDkNcrmJJLAkQjS3rXj